Hands of Hope Hospice is now 25 years old. Resource Specialist Jim Pierce, who has been with the program since the beginning, says Hands of Hope provides a caring companion for patient and family on life’s final journey.
Pierce says the forerunner of Hands of Hope began in the early 80s when the hospice movement was just getting started. That volunteer program folded after the merger that created Heartland Health. Heartland launched Hands of Hope in 1987. It now serves 11 Northwest Missouri counties out of offices in Saint Joseph and Stanberry.
